Lyons garner five All-America performances at NCAA ChampionshipMarch 12, 2005 BLOOMINGTON, IL- The Wheaton College women's indoor track and field team sent five of its student-athletes to this weekend's NCAA Division III Championship at Illinois Wesleyan University and the Lyons will return to the Norton campus with all five garnering All-America performances. Sophomore Jennifer Harlow (East Bridgewater, MA/East Bridgewater) led Wheaton in the high jump, tying for fifth with a height of 5' 3 1/4". Senior captain Kathrine Wallace (Glenmoore, PA/The Hill School) also cleared 5' 3 1/4" to finish 12th overall. Wallace then anchored Wheaton's 4x400-meter relay team in this evening's final event, joining senior captain Jessica Allegra (East Hampton, CT/East Hampton) and first-year athletes Julie McLane (New Canaan, CT/New Canaan) and Chelsea Nader (Ardmore, PA/Lower Menan) to finish eighth in 3:59.24. The Lyons totaled 4.5 points and placed 39th overall among the 60 scoring teams. Wheaton will open its outdoor season next weekend at the Long Beach State Classic at Long Beach State University.
